Analysis

In 2009, tax revenue in Iran, Islamic Republic of stood at 7.4%.

Compared with earlier readings it is up 18.7% on the previous year and down 11.6% over ten years.

Over the whole period, tax revenue in Iran, Islamic Republic of peaked at 10.2% in 1997 and was at its lowest, 3.9%, in 1993.

That places Iran, Islamic Republic of 143rd out of 157 countries with data for 2009, putting it in the bottom quarter.

The long-run direction has been consistently falling across the 38 years of available data.

Tax revenue in Iran, Islamic Republic of, year by year

Annual values for Tax revenue (% of GDP) in Iran, Islamic Republic of, 1972 to 2009.
Year % of GDP Change
1972 8.3%
1973 7.5% -8.7%
1974 5.4% -28.2%
1975 8.2% +51.2%
1976 7.6% -7.7%
1977 8.2% +8.7%
1978 8.9% +8.0%
1979 6.0% -32.4%
1980 5.2% -13.7%
1981 7.0% +35.0%
1982 5.9% -15.1%
1983 6.0% +1.9%
1984 6.4% +6.7%
1985 7.3% +13.9%
1986 6.8% -7.4%
1987 6.0% -11.5%
1988 5.4% -9.5%
1989 5.4% -1.2%
1990 5.6% +3.8%
1991 6.2% +10.6%
1992 6.9% +11.7%
1993 3.9% -43.9%
1994 4.4% +13.2%
1995 6.2% +42.3%
1996 7.9% +27.7%
1997 10.2% +27.8%
1998 8.6% -14.9%
1999 8.3% -3.7%
2000 5.9% -29.6%
2001 5.7% -2.0%
2002 5.0% -13.1%
2003 5.2% +4.1%
2004 5.2% -0.1%
2005 6.7% +28.1%
2006 6.2% -6.6%
2007 5.9% -4.5%
2008 6.2% +4.4%
2009 7.4% +18.7%

Taxes are compulsory, unrequited payments, in cash or in kind, made by institutional units to government units. This indicator is expressed as a percentage of Gross Domestic Product (GDP) which is the total income earned through the production of goods and services in an economic territory during an accounting period.
